What we collect

We collect only what is needed to run the Service: your email address and password when you create an account, and the meetup details you choose to publish. When you contact an organizer or apply to a private meetup, we collect the email address and message you submit so we can deliver them.

What we never do

  • We never detect, request, or store your device location. Search is based only on the city and country you type in.
  • We never display an organizer's email address to anyone, under any circumstances. Messages and applications are forwarded by us; organizers choose whether to reply.
  • We never sell your personal information.

Private meetups

Private meetup listings show only general information (name, approximate city, type, expected ages, and activities). Dates, times, and addresses of private meetups are never published on the site — they are shared only by the organizer with people they approve.

Third-party services

We use OpenStreetMap (run by the non-profit OpenStreetMap Foundation) to display maps and convert typed city names into map coordinates. We deliberately avoid ad-supported map providers.
